Much of casino news we get from Japan is about the proposed Integrated Resorts, or IRs. Prefectures across the country are submitting proposals to the central government. This is to be able to host the locations of the three planned IRs. One of the more vocal areas to lobby for an IR grant is Osaka. Osaka, last year alone, was host to more than 12 million tourists. And if the prefecture gains an IR, then this number could substantially increase in the next few years.
Osaka IR to Benefit Local Economy
Officials from Osaka predict that by having an IR built, they can have as much as 24.8 million visitors – and this number does not include tourists who are in Osaka for other purposes. The prefecture commissioned a study on the IR and how the IR will affect the area. And if this happens, Osaka can contribute as much as $6.87 billion to the country’s economy.
The plan, called Osaka IR Fundamentals Plan, or OIRFP, has a few initiatives for the IR. Which can accommodate development of as big as 148 acres, with a total floor area of 10,763,910.4 square feet (roughly a million square meters). This is compliant to the minimum 1-million-square- foot requirement of the Japanese IR Development and Promotion Ordinance.
This development will be about $8.5 billion to make. The area will have a casino, international conference centers, commercial and entertainment facilities. The estimates for revenue from this IR could be as high as $4.4 billion annually. This, of course, will not just boost the local economy through revenue, but through job generation as well. Security from the police will also be added, as well as measures and facilities for operators to help people with gambling addiction problems.
